Abstract: (APS)
We investigate new aspects related to the Abelian gauge-Higgs model with the addition of the Carroll-Field-Jackiw term. We focus on one-loop quantum corrections to the photon and Higgs sectors due to spontaneous breaking of gauge symmetry and show that new finite and definite Lorentz-breaking terms are induced. Specifically in the gauge sector, a CPT-even aether term is induced. Besides, aspects of the one-loop renormalization of the background vector-dependent terms are discussed.
